Why AI Needs Cloud Infrastructure

Artificial intelligence relies heavily on computing resources. Whether it is training machine learning models, processing images, running predictive analytics, or generating real-time recommendations, AI consumes significant processing power, storage, and memory.

Traditional on-premise servers often struggle to meet these requirements. Businesses would need to purchase expensive hardware, maintain dedicated infrastructure, and continuously upgrade systems as workloads increase.

Cloud servers eliminate these challenges by providing on-demand computing resources. Instead of investing heavily in physical infrastructure, businesses can instantly access the processing power they need whenever they need it.

This flexibility allows organizations to focus on innovation rather than infrastructure management.

1. Unlimited Scalability for AI Workloads

AI workloads are unpredictable.

A machine learning application might require minimal resources during development but suddenly need hundreds of virtual CPUs when processing millions of customer records.

Cloud servers provide instant scalability.

Resources such as CPU, RAM, GPU, storage, and networking can be increased or decreased within minutes without replacing physical hardware.

This flexibility ensures that AI applications always receive the computing power they require while avoiding unnecessary infrastructure costs during low-demand periods.

For growing businesses, this scalability removes one of the biggest barriers to AI adoption.

2. Faster AI Model Training

Training AI models involves processing enormous amounts of data.

Without sufficient computing resources, model training can take several days or even weeks.

Cloud infrastructure dramatically reduces training time by providing high-performance computing environments equipped with powerful processors and GPU-enabled servers.

Faster training means businesses can:

  • Build models more quickly
  • Test multiple algorithms
  • Improve prediction accuracy
  • Deploy new AI features faster

This accelerates innovation while reducing development cycles.

3. Cost-Effective Infrastructure

One of the greatest advantages of cloud-based AI is cost efficiency.

Building an AI-ready data center requires major investments in:

  • Physical servers
  • Networking equipment
  • Storage systems
  • Cooling infrastructure
  • Power management
  • Security systems
  • IT personnel

Cloud servers replace large capital expenses with predictable operational costs.

Businesses pay only for the resources they consume.

This makes advanced AI technology accessible even for startups and medium-sized organizations.

8. High Availability and Reliability

Downtime can severely impact AI-powered applications.

Imagine an AI customer support system or recommendation engine becoming unavailable during peak business hours.

Cloud servers are designed for high availability through redundant infrastructure, automatic failover mechanisms, and distributed architecture.

This ensures AI services remain available even when hardware failures occur.

Reliable infrastructure improves customer satisfaction and business continuity.

Industry Applications of AI and Cloud Integration

The combination of AI and cloud computing is transforming nearly every industry.

In healthcare, AI assists doctors with medical imaging, disease prediction, and patient monitoring while cloud servers securely store electronic health records and enable collaboration across medical institutions.

In education, cloud-based AI personalizes learning experiences, automates assessments, and provides intelligent tutoring systems that adapt to each student’s progress.

Transportation companies use AI to optimize delivery routes, monitor vehicle performance, predict maintenance requirements, and manage intelligent traffic systems using scalable cloud infrastructure.

Retail businesses rely on AI for demand forecasting, personalized recommendations, customer segmentation, and inventory optimization, all powered by cloud-based computing resources.

Financial institutions use AI for fraud detection, risk analysis, customer service automation, and algorithmic trading while leveraging the security and scalability of cloud platforms.
